Luigi Girolamo Cusani-Confalonieri

Luigi Girolamo Cusani-Confalonieri (April 15, 1861 – March 10, 1934), was the Ambassador of Italy to the United States from November 1, 1910 to May 29, 1914 when he was replaced by Vincenzo Macchi Di Cellere.[1][2] He was the Ambassador of Italy to Japan from April 9, 1917 to February 17, 1920.
